    Went here to watch a basketball game with my husband. There is a small parking lot in the back. We got a table in front of the big tv. I believe the manager was who took care of us. Got our drink order right away. We ordered a bucket of high noons which I thought was a good deal. For food, we ordered chicken wings and nachos. The food took a little long to come out but they told us that ahead of time. We weren't in a hurry anyway since we were watching.m the game. Lots of different flavors for the wings. We chose honey sriracha which was tasty with a little heat. The pork nachos were a good size. We were full after that. Although you could call this a dive bar, the restrooms were clean. Overall had a good time. When I was done drinking, our server brought over some waters so we could stay hydrated.

    We wanted somewhere super casual, near downtown as we had another stop there, and Mexican sounded good. It is an unassuming establishment and calls itself a 'vibe' vs a dive bar. It's a dive bar IMO with really great food. They are located on colonial and although they have signage, it's easy to pass. They have several parking spots but it was a slow night and that lot was half full, so I imagine it would be hard to park there for games and such. This is not generally my scene, but we were thoroughly impressed. They had a jukebox, dart throwing and sports on. It was loud but we could communicate. Our server was Mark. He was incredible. He was managing several tables and the phones - all at the same time. The menu is impressive for such a small place and leans to bar food and Mexican. There are even a few Vegan and other specialty options. And they have happy hour too. I noticed that a lot of the food options were listed as spicy and that's not what I wanted. So, I custom-made a quesadilla. It was huge and so very good (one piece pictured). One of the best I've had here in Orlando and not overloaded with cheese - the perfect amount. My husband had 3 pork tacos and couldn't finish them. They were also very, very good. We had leftovers which was nice. And, they have great prices! I think our bill (without the discount) was only about $35!! I had a basic $5 glass of wine and he had a Corona. Not bad and satisfied the craving. If you are down there and looking for this vibe and food, check them out. We will definitely go again!
